About Converting Kilograms per Cubic Meter to Grams per Gallon

Kilogram per Cubic Meter and Gram per Gallon both measure mass concentration — how much of a substance is dissolved or dispersed in a given volume — a core calculation for preparing lab solutions, checking water quality against a regulatory limit, or formulating a pharmaceutical dose. Kilogram per Cubic Meter is most often used for physics and engineering reference density values.

Formula

grams per gallon = kilograms per cubic meter × 3.785411784

This factor comes from each unit's defined relationship to the category's base unit: 1 kilogram per cubic meter equals 1 base unit, and 1 gram per gallon equals 0.264172052358 base units, so dividing one by the other gives the direct kilogram per cubic meter-to-gram per gallon factor of 3.785411784.

Understanding the Kilogram per Cubic Meter

Kilogram per Cubic Meter (kg/m3) measures density. The SI coherent unit for density — the form all other metric density/concentration units in this catalog are ultimately defined relative to. It is classified as a SI coherent derived unit.

Where it's used: Universal — the official SI unit for density, used throughout physics and engineering worldwide

kg/m³ vs. g/L vs. kg/L. All three are exactly related: 1 kg/m³ = 1 g/L, and 1,000 kg/m³ = 1 kg/L. kg/m³ is the formal SI-coherent form; g/L and kg/L are more commonly used in everyday and laboratory contexts.

Uses of the Kilogram per Cubic Meter today

  • Physics and engineering reference density values
  • Material property tables in scientific literature
  • Fluid dynamics and structural engineering calculations
